AETOS Details

The AETOS group was set up in 2007 and includes the Australian-based AETOS Capital Pty Group Ltd, regulated by the Australian Securities and Investment Commission (ASIC) and the UK-based AETOS Capital Group (UK) Ltd, reg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A).

The broker has offices in Sydney and London and provides financial services to residents in over 100 countries.

Assets

The broker offers trading on a range of prime assets:

Shares CFDs (AU only) – Wide range of Australian and US shares such as Apple and 3M
Indices – Global indices including UK100 and HKG50
Forex – 27 currency pairs both major and exotic
Energy – Including UK and US crude oil
Metals – Gold, silver, and copper

Although AETOS offers a good selection of financial instruments, its rank in our review could be bettered with the addition of cryptocurrency trading.

Trading Fees

AETOS offers relatively low-cost trading and tight spreads. For the general account, the typical EUR/USD spread is 1.8 pips which drops to 1.2 pips with the advanced account. For the FTSE100 index futures CFD, the typical spread is 25 pips with both live accounts.

The broker also charges an overnight open position fee, which is fairly standard in the industry. This review would have liked to see lower spreads offered for the advanced account type, as other large brokers offer close-to-zero spreads.

Leverage Review

Both branches of AETOS offer leveraged trading. The Australia-based arm offers leverage up to 1:200 for forex and between 1:100 and 1:400 for energy, indices, metals, and shares. The UK-based branch offers maximum leverage of 1:30 on their products, depending on volatility, in line with European guidelines.

Payments

Deposits

AETOS traders have to deposit a minimum of $250 with the general account and $1,000 with the advanced account. Clients can deposit funds into their trading account by wire transfer, Visa/MasterCard, or digital wallets such as Skrill or Neteller. Payment methods other than Visa are free of charge. Lead times are 1-5 business days for wire transfer and up to 1 business day for other methods.

Withdrawals

To start the withdrawal process, traders should login to their trade account and select the withdrawal function. Payments can be processed by wire transfer, taking up to 5 business days, and clients are charged $25 if no valid trading is registered on their account.

Demo Account

AETOS offers a 14-day demo account to trade with $10,000 in virtual funds. Clients can practice on the markets trading forex and CFDs. The simulator account is an excellent way to test the MT4 platform, customer support and trading tools.

Joining Bonuses

The Australian branch of AETOS is currently offering a redeemable deposit joining bonus. The promotion pays a bonus of up to $20,000 depending on the amount deposited. The offer becomes redeemable if clients meet volume trading requirements inside 7 months of opening an account. AETOS does not offer a no deposit bonus at present.

The UK branch of AETOS does not currently offer any promotional bonuses due to European restrictions on retail trading incentives.

Regulation

AETOS is regulated by well-respected financial authorities; the ASIC, the FCA, the VFSC, and CIMA.

The Australian arm is licensed by the Australian Securities and Investment Commission (ASIC), which includes membership to the Australian Financial Complaints Authority to resolve disputes between clients and firms.

The UK arm is reg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) and is part of the Financial Services Compensation Scheme, which protects clients of firms that are unable to return user funds. The UK arm also provides negative balance protection, so losses greater than the initial deposit are avoided.

Additionally, AETOS holds licenses with the Vanuatu Financial Services Commission (VFSC) and the Cayman Islands Monetary Authority (CIMA).

AETOS Accounts

The General account offers a relatively low minimum deposit, trading volume from 0.01 lots, and rapid market execution. The brokerage also offers an Advanced account suited to high-net-worth clients, requiring a larger deposit in return for more competitive spreads. Both accounts have a maximum position size of 50 lots.

Clients can also apply for a professional account via the website. Applicants must meet criteria including a high trading frequency maintained over the past year and a strong portfolio, alongside previous employment in the financial sector.
